Privilege Escalation and Authentication Bypass in OpenSTAManager Software by DevCode
CVE-2026-27012
9.8CRITICAL
What is CVE-2026-27012?
OpenSTAManager, an open-source management software for technical assistance and invoicing, has a significant vulnerability that allows attackers to manipulate user privileges. Specifically, in versions 2.9.8 and earlier, an attacker can exploit this vulnerability by making direct calls to the 'modules/utenti/actions.php' file. This enables unauthorized changes to a user's group, allowing an existing account to be promoted to the Amministratori group or even demote any user, including administrators. As a result, this flaw poses a serious risk to the integrity of user roles and overall system security.
Affected Version(s)
openstamanager <= 2.9.8
